Guidelines to Consider When Purchasing Surfboard Leash
When purchasing a surfboard leash, several key factors must be considered to ensure safety, performance, and comfort while surfing. A leash is not just a safety accessory; it is a critical piece of equipment that connects the surfer to their board, preventing the board from drifting away after a wipeout and helping to avoid potential hazards to other surfers and swimmers. Choosing the right leash involves evaluating its length, thickness, cuff comfort, and swivel mechanisms, all of which contribute to the overall surfing experience. Since conditions and personal preferences vary widely among surfers, it’s important to match the leash to the type of surfing being done, the size of the waves, and the board being used. A poorly chosen leash can negatively impact maneuverability or even snap under pressure, while the right one enhances confidence and safety in the water.
One of the primary considerations when selecting a surfboard leash is its length. Generally, the rule of thumb is that the leash should be about the same length as the surfboard itself. For example, if you’re using a 6-foot shortboard, a 6-foot leash is typically recommended. If the leash is too short, it can pull the board back toward you too quickly after a fall, increasing the risk of injury. On the other hand, a leash that is too long can create unnecessary drag and may become tangled more easily, especially in smaller surf where close control over the board is crucial. However, there are situations where a slightly longer leash may be appropriate, such as in big wave surfing, where distance from the board can provide additional safety. Choosing the correct length is therefore essential for achieving a balance between control and freedom in the water.
Another important factor to examine is the thickness or diameter of the leash cord. The thickness of a leash affects both its strength and the amount of drag it creates in the water. Thicker leashes, typically around 7mm, are stronger and more durable, making them ideal for bigger waves and heavier boards such as longboards. These leashes can better withstand the forces of larger surf but may also create more drag, which can slow down performance and responsiveness. Thinner leashes, around 5mm or less, are designed for smaller waves and lighter boards, such as high-performance shortboards. They generate less drag and offer greater flexibility, allowing for quicker turns and smoother rides. However, they are more prone to breaking under pressure. Therefore, selecting a leash with the appropriate thickness based on wave size and board type is crucial for ensuring durability without sacrificing maneuverability.
Comfort and fit of the ankle cuff are often overlooked but play a significant role in the overall effectiveness of a surfboard leash. The cuff is the part that attaches to the surfer’s ankle or calf, depending on the style of leash and personal preference. A good cuff should be padded and made of soft, durable materials that prevent chafing and discomfort during long sessions in the water. It should also provide a secure fit without being overly tight, which can restrict blood flow or movement. Velcro closures must be strong and reliable to avoid accidental detachment during rough wipeouts. Some advanced models feature quick-release tabs that allow surfers to remove the leash swiftly in emergencies, an important feature in big wave surfing or reef breaks. The right cuff enhances the overall surfing experience by remaining comfortable and secure, even after hours in the ocean.
Finally, the swivel mechanism is a crucial but sometimes underappreciated element in leash design. Most quality leashes come with at least one swivel, usually located at the point where the cuff meets the cord, and often a second one where the cord attaches to the rail saver. These swivels prevent the leash from twisting and tangling, a common annoyance that can affect board control and movement. A tangled leash can not only hinder performance but also increase the risk of tripping or becoming entangled during a wipeout. Double swivels are particularly beneficial for high-performance surfing, where the board is subject to frequent and rapid directional changes. Swivels made of stainless steel or other corrosion-resistant materials also ensure longevity, especially in saltwater conditions. When evaluating leashes, checking the quality and functionality of the swivels can make a noticeable difference in both performance and safety.
